The firm of Miller, Somervail & Black, although untraced in Jackson's, is registered in the 1853 Glasgow Trade and Post Office Directory as 'silversmiths, 28 St. Enoch's Wynd.'  Sotheby's extends its thanks to Elspeth Morrison at The Goldsmiths' Hall, Edinburgh, for her assistance with this identification.
